Re: Serious question: What is IU's record with Georgia's schedule?
« Reply #29 on: November 20, 2024, 10:28:58 AM »
Texas had what looked like a good win at Michigan on the road at the time.  They beat Oklahoma soundly, again, not looking now like a thing.  The 3 point win at Vandy was shortened by a late Vandy TD.  They also looked mortal at Arkansas.  They looked up at the scoreboard against UGA and thought the start of the game must have already happened.  So, no highly impressive wins there.  

As someone noted, Tennessee doesn't have a much different slate though they did beat Bama and were upset by Arkansas and beat Florida in OT.  They looked very good at UGA for a few minutes.
